Calypso Waterpark is the summertime place to be for children and thrill seekers alike. As the biggest waterpark in Canada, this $65 million investment features a wide variety of attractions for people of all ages: 35 slides, 100 water games and two theme rivers! It is also home to the largest wavepool in the country, exciting slides for everyone, play areas for young families, three VIP Zones and a great selection of restaurants. History
2010
- June 7, 2010 – Opening of the waterpark
2011
- New Summit Tower, the highest free-standing waterslide tower in Canada, with 10 new waterslides, including two AquaLoops, four high-speed waterslides and four serpentine slides for the entire family. This new attraction represented an investment of $5 million.
- New VIP Zone with luxurious and private cabanas.
2012
- New Jungle Challenge and many improvements made to the waterpark’s existing installations, representing a total investment of $1 million.
2013
- New Kongo Expedition, a theme river through the African savana, three new restaurants (a submarine shop, fast-food restaurant and dairy bar) and a new wooded area with 150 picnic tables, representing an investment of $7 million.
- Eight new luxurious and private Cabanas in Calypso Waterpark’s VIP Zone.
2016
- New luxurious Palace Suites, located in the middle of the action next to the wave pool.
2025
- A stunning new entrance plus a revamped Mainstreet with an arcade, shop, and dining.
